General Description:The primary duty of the Finance Manager is to assist the Director of Finance in managing all aspects of the finance operations for the Armour College of Engineering, including budget, payroll, graduate income tuition vouchers (ITVs), accounts payable, accounts receivable, and general ledgers. Working closely with department chair(s), faculty, and administrative staff, this position coordinates a broad range of activities and functions to ensure effective and efficient operations within the department(s) to advance financial planning activities in and on behalf of the Armour College of Engineering (ACE) related to the implementation of strategic fiscal initiatives identified as priorities in achieving the College's mission, in accordance with established university practices, policies, and procedures. This position is a member of the financial team within the engineering college.Department:
